Let’s first get to the heart of the matter: what exactly does a foaming agent do? While it might seem like a minor detail, the truth is it has a powerful impact—especially when it comes to reducing pesticide drift. You may wonder, what’s this drift business anyway? Drift refers to the phenomenon where pesticide particles hitch a ride on the wind and wander away from the intended application area. This can pose risks to non-target organisms and environments—as well as you, the practitioner.

So, how does a foaming agent step in to save the day? Like a loyal sidekick, it generates a thick foam that acts as a barrier against drift. By creating this added layer, the pesticide adheres better to the surface and stays put where it's supposed to be. Picture this: you're applying a pesticide on a breezy day, with those little particles threatening to flee into neighboring gardens. By using a foaming agent, you can keep your application in check, allowing for better control—especially when applying to vertical surfaces like the sides of buildings or trees.
